Fig. 2: Forced expression of CRAT suppressed OC growth by inducing cell cycle arrest and apoptosis.

From: CRAT downregulation promotes ovarian cancer progression by facilitating mitochondrial metabolism through decreasing the acetylation of PGC-1α

Fig. 2

A, B Overexpression of CRAT was determined by qRT-PCR and western blot analysis in two OC cell lines named HEY and SKOV3 (EV, empty vector; CRAT, expression vector encoding CRAT). CE MTS cell viability C, colony formation D and EdU staining E assays were performed in HEY and SKOV3 cells with CRAT overexpressing. F The effect of CRAT overexpressing on cell cycle distribution was determined by flow cytometry analysis in HEY and SKOV3 cells. G The effect of CRAT overexpressing on cell apoptosis was determined by flow cytometry analysis in HEY and SKOV3 cells. Data presented as mean ± SEM of triplicate independent experiments, *P < 0.05.
